The Dynamic Weigh High-Speed Checkweigher (JDS Series) is an inline weighing system manufactured by Jiangsu Jutian Weighing Equipment Co., Ltd. It is designed for production lines where 100% product weight verification is required at line speed, without interrupting product flow. The equipment captures weight readings while products are in motion on the conveyor, compares each reading against preset limits, and triggers a sorting mechanism to separate non-conforming items.

Dynamic weighing differs from static weighing in that the measurement is taken during conveyor movement. The system compensates for mechanical vibration and product motion through a combination of digital filtering algorithms and mechanically isolated load cells. Accuracy specifications are therefore interdependent with conveyor speed, product dimensions, and product weight—a relationship accounted for during system configuration.

Note on accuracy: Detection accuracy is influenced by product weight, dimensions, conveyor speed, and environmental conditions. Stated accuracy ranges represent achievable performance under controlled factory testing with representative product samples. On-site commissioning establishes actual performance under production conditions.

Dynamic Weighing Technology

Sensor and signal processing: The JDS Series uses strain gauge load cells configured in a mechanically isolated weighing section. The conveyor belt over the weighing zone is supported entirely by the load cell assembly, separated from the drive motor and upstream/downstream conveyors by gaps or transfer rollers. This mechanical isolation reduces the transmission of motor vibration into the weighing signal.

Digital filtering and speed compensation: Weight readings are sampled at high frequency during the brief period each product passes over the weighing zone. Digital filtering algorithms extract a stable weight value from the dynamic signal, compensating for residual vibration and belt movement. The system's throughput capacity is determined by product length, conveyor speed, and the minimum time required for the weighing signal to stabilize.

Product Parameter Management & Sorting Logic

The touchscreen controller stores parameter sets for multiple products, including target weight, upper/lower tolerance limits, conveyor speed, and sorting mode. When a product is selected, all associated parameters load automatically, reducing changeover time between different SKUs. The system supports weight-based classification into multiple grades (e.g., underweight, acceptable, overweight) with configurable sorting actions for each grade.

Sorting mechanisms are specified during system configuration based on product characteristics and line layout. Common options include pneumatic push arms for lateral rejection, air blast nozzles for lightweight products, and drop flaps or diverter gates for integration with downstream conveyors. The reject confirmation sensor verifies that non-conforming items have been successfully removed before the next product arrives.

Operational Reliability in Industrial Environments

The structural frame is fabricated from stainless steel 304, selected for durability and compatibility with washdown environments common in food and pharmaceutical production. The touchscreen controller and electrical enclosure are sealed to IP65 or higher, depending on configuration. Wiring and sensor connections are routed through sealed conduits. The system is designed for continuous multi-shift operation, with bearings and belts specified for the intended duty cycle.

Calibration is performed through the touchscreen interface using guided single-point or multi-point procedures with certified test weights. Routine maintenance—including belt inspection, sensor zero check, and conveyor alignment verification—is accessible without specialized tools.

FAQ (Frequently Asked Questions)

How does conveyor speed affect weighing accuracy?
Accuracy and speed are interdependent in dynamic weighing. Higher conveyor speeds reduce the time each product spends on the weighing zone, which can increase measurement variation. During system configuration, the engineering team specifies the achievable accuracy at the required throughput based on product weight and dimensions. Accuracy figures are verified during on-site commissioning with actual production samples.

What mechanisms prevent vibration from affecting weight readings?
Two design approaches are used: mechanical isolation and digital signal processing. The weighing section is mechanically separated from the drive motor and adjacent conveyors to minimize vibration transmission. On the signal side, digital filtering algorithms process the high-frequency weight samples to extract a stable value despite residual environmental vibration.

How does the system handle multiple products on the same line?
Product parameters—including target weight, tolerance limits, conveyor speed, and sorting action—are stored as named presets in the controller. Operators select the active product from the touchscreen menu, and all parameters load automatically. Changeover between presets does not require recalibration.

What data traceability features are included?
Each weight measurement is timestamped and logged with the product identifier, measured weight, tolerance status (pass/fail), and sorting result. Data can be exported via USB in CSV format or transmitted to a host system via Ethernet or serial connection. Statistical summaries—including total count, pass rate, and weight distribution—are viewable on the touchscreen in real time.

How is the sorting mechanism selected for a specific application?
Sorting mechanism selection depends on product weight, dimensions, packaging type, conveyor speed, and available line space. Pneumatic push arms are commonly used for cartons and rigid containers. Air blast systems are suitable for lightweight flexible packages. The engineering review stage determines the appropriate mechanism based on the customer's product specifications and line layout.
